Authority Signals: Awards, Roofing Products Warranties, and Certifications
- Which associations and certificates premium clients trust
- Showcasing roofing systems warranties and peace of mind guarantees
Elite clients gravitate to authority signals: GAF Master Elite badges, CertainTeed Select ShingleMaster status, membership in regional builder associations, and proof of insurance. Pair these with warranties that beat industry standards—even on traditional roof repairs—to boost confidence in your services. Dedicated sections for certifications and awards visually prove quality, professionalism, and your commitment to delivering lasting protection that’s backed by a warranty.

Technical Improvements for Extreme Weather Locations
- Faster load times, image optimization for roofing systems
- Schema and FAQ markup for enhanced search presence
Technical SEO for a high-end roofing website means more than basics. Compress images of roofing materials for speedy load even on mobile connections, add structured data (schema) to highlight projects and reviews, and use location keywords for your service areas. Don’t overlook FAQ and PAA markup for rich snippets—this provides the answers high-value clients want right in search results.
| SEO Focus Area | Best Practices | Impact |
|---|---|---|
| High-Intent Keywords | Integrate “roofing system”, “asphalt shingle”, “roofing solutions”, and long-tail location terms on service pages | Increases lead quality and local visibility |
| Image Optimization | Compress, use descriptive alt text (e.g., “Premium asphalt shingles in extreme weather”) | Boosts speed and search ranking |
| Schema Markup | Add Local Business, Reviews, Project schema | Enhances appearance in search and trust |
| Mobile Performance | Responsive layout, fast load, touch-friendly forms | Captures clients searching on their phone |
| Reviews & Trust Signals | Embed Google reviews, display certifications and warranties | Builds trust and drives conversions |
